How to Format a Cover Letter?

  • Set one-inch margins on all sides.
  • Left-align all contents.
  • Use business letter format spacing: 1 or 1.15.
  • Put double spaces between paragraphs.
  • Optionally, include a digital copy of your handwritten signature in your sign-off.
  • Save your cover letter in PDF.

Should you sign a cover letter?

Do you need to sign a cover letter? No, you don’t need to sign a cover letter. However, if you’re mailing a hard copy as part of your application, you should sign your cover letter because it’s professional and requires little effort.

Should I put my cover letter and resume in one document?

1answer. Including your cover letter and resume in a single file can seem tidier and more efficient. While it depends on the individual hiring manager, sending it in two files is generally preferable. These two documents serve different functions in the application process.

Is it better to attach cover letter or email?

Unless an employer specifically asks for you to include your cover letter and your resume in the body of your email, send them as separate email attachments. You should always write a real cover letter and attach it to the email.
